Online Banking Manager jobs in Allenton, WI

Online Banking Manager oversees online banking activities. Develops policies and procedures for electronic banking processes to ensure compliance with established standards and regulations. Being an Online Banking Manager directs support operations to resolve customer issues with online tools. Participates in the maintenance and development of the bank's online products and services. Additionally, Online Banking Manager requ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a director. The Online Banking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be an Online Banking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Manage and develop a portfolio of commercial relationships and ensure retention of total client assets and net growth in relationships, while complying with established Associated Bank risk management and credit policy, business strategy and regulatory guidelines.

    Job Accountabilities

    • Responsible for loan and deposit growth through client portfolio, centers of influence and other proactive measures to grow market share, as well as retain/grow existing portfolio.
    • Responsible for working collaboratively with internal partners to cross sell all bank products and services, especially non-borrowing services, including Commercial Deposit & Treasury Management (CDTM), Capital Markets, Private Banking, Wealth Management & Institutional Services, Associated Financial Group, Employee Benefit Services, Retail Bank-at-work, etc., to our existing client base and to prospective customers.
    • Ensure the portfolio administration and risk management of each client relationship is in compliance with established Associated Banc-Corp credit policy, procedure and business strategy as well as commercial and regulatory guidelines.
    • Provide financial advice and counsel to clients and prospective clients regarding trends and conditions of the business environment and general banking trends though bank approved sources.
    • Develop commercial banking relationships by profiling and analyzing financial data, along with the Portfolio Manager, to determine the merits of specific loan requests and recommend structure.
    • Make presentations on specific loans and participate in the bank's loan approval process, recommending approval and appropriate structure of credits, along with the Portfolio Manager.
    • Identify needs and refer customers to partners within and across lines of business who can best meet those needs.
    • Participate in community and business functions/groups to ensure a positive image for the bank. Establish referral contacts within the community. Serve on community, corporate or not-for-profit boards, as applicable.


    Education

    Bachelor's Degree or equivalent combination of education and experience Business, Finance or Accounting Required

    Experience

    6 years Commercial banking or business to business sales and strong business development skills. Knowledge of non-borrowing products, past track records of sales and client management success. Required

Allenton, Wisconsin is an unincorporated census-designated place in the town of Addison, Wisconsin in Washington County, Wisconsin. It is located near the intersection of Wisconsin Highway 33 and Interstate 41. It is on a line of the Canadian National Railway, parent company of the Wisconsin Central Ltd. railroad. Allenton has a post office with ZIP code 53002. As of the 2010 census, its population was 823. Allenton is located at latitude 43.421 and longitude -88.341. The elevation is 958 feet.
